TROJAN 404
Step into the shadows of a hyper-connected world in TROJAN 404, a fan-made tribute and reimagining of the iconic Watch Dogs universe rebuilt from the ground up in Unreal Engine 5.
This is more than a visual remake it’s a fresh take on the hacker-action genre, combining cinematic environments, next-gen gameplay mechanics, and deep immersion. Currently in the prototype phase, TROJAN 404 aims to showcase what's possible when passion meets powerful tools.
🔧 Key Features (Prototype Preview)
⚡ Unreal Engine 5 Visuals
Experience atmospheric, high-fidelity environments with real-time lighting, detailed textures, and cinematic mood — powered by UE5's cutting-edge tech.
🏃 Dynamic Movement System
Freely explore urban playgrounds with an advanced parkour system, including wall running, vaulting, dashing, and tic-tac climbing. Move how you want, where you want.
🥊 Free-Flow Combat
Inspired by fast-paced action titles, the prototype features fluid, responsive melee combat. Chain attacks, teleport between enemies, and leave behind neon trails for that stylish edge.
💻 Hacking Is Your Weapon
Take control of surveillance cameras, unlock digital doors via puzzle-based hacks, or deploy an RC car to sneak through tight spaces — or cause chaos remotely.
📌 Note from the Developer
TROJAN 404 is currently in prototype stage and is being built as a personal showcase project. Everything you see is part of an ongoing experiment in gameplay design, visual style, and immersive mechanics.
